Analysis
In 2023, pre- and post-production — emissions in Trinidad and Tobago stood at 17,999 kt. That is the highest value across all 34 years on record.
That represents a change of up 34.5% over ten years.
Over the whole period, pre- and post-production — emissions in Trinidad and Tobago peaked at 17,999 kt in 2023 and was at its lowest, 10,250 kt, in 1993.
Trinidad and Tobago ranks 34th of 220 countries on this measure, in the top quarter.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
